Answer:

nitrogen cycle

Explanation:

Nitrogen enters the living world by way of bacteria and other single-celled prokaryotes, which convert atmospheric nitrogen— N 2 \text N_2 N2​start text, N, end text, start subscript, 2, end subscript—into biologically usable forms in a process called nitrogen fixation.

The white portion of the tough outer coat of the eye is called the ________.
Free_Kalibri [48]

Answer:

Sclera

Explanation:

Sclera is also known as the white of the eye. Sclera is the tough white portion of the outer coat of the eye.

Sclera protects the eye from the inside and helps in maintaining the eye structure. Sclera mainly consists of collagen and elastic fibers. Sclera increases the nonverbal communication in an organism.

Which of the following does a bacteriophage NOT have?
solong [7]

Bacteriophage doesn't have a nucleus.

Option C.

<h3><u>Explanation:</u></h3>

Bacteriophage is a virus that is present in our surroundings. Its a phage virus that attacks bacteria and killing it. Bacteriophage has a tadpole like structure with a polygonal head and a neck and 6 tails. The polygonal head is formed of carbohydrates, along with the neck and tails. The head has inside it DNA that is its nucleic acid and genetic material. It's not enclosed in any nucleus. It has some proteins inside the head too.

The phage virus attaches itself with bacteria and drills the bacterial cell wall by the neck and pushes the genetic material inside as a mode of infection.

In what way is, Chlorella, similar to a plant cell/ plant kingdom
vazorg [7]
Chlorella is a genus of about thirteen species of single-celled green algae belonging to the division Chlorophyta. The cells are spherical in shape, about 2 to 10 μm in diameter, and are without flagella. Their chloroplasts contain the green photosynthetic pigments chlorophyll-a and -b. In ideal conditions cells of Chlorella multiply rapidly, requiring only carbon dioxide, water, sunlight, and a small amount of minerals to reproduce.
